VSI在粒子群算法中怎么表示
时间: 2024-04-29 13:10:26 浏览: 82
在粒子群算法中,VSI通常表示粒子的速度向量。具体来说,对于一个粒子的位置向量X,其速度向量VSI可以表示为:
VSI = w * VSI + c1 * r1 * (pbest - X) + c2 * r2 * (gbest - X)
其中,w是惯性权重,通常取值在[0,1]之间;c1和c2分别是个体和全局学习因子;r1和r2是[0,1]之间的随机数;pbest是粒子自身历史最优位置;gbest是所有粒子历史最优位置。
通过更新VSI,可以更新粒子的位置向量X,从而达到优化目标的效果。
阅读全文